The Voice That Keeps You Company

Author: Annette Malave, SVP/Insights, RAB

During RAB’s team coverage of CES 2020, John Holdridge of Fullscreen, a social content company, believes that there is a pending social recession. He said that people may “optimize their time for their health and well-being, there may be a point of turn-off for social.” How can eliminating social media be beneficial to a person’s health and well-being? According to a survey sponsored by the Cigna Health Insurance Company, loneliness is at an all-time high and triggered using social media. On the other hand, some studies have pointed to audio and voice as an aid to battle loneliness.
